Novel Inpatient Automated Self-Adjusting Subcutaneous Insulin Algorithm: 3-Year Experience. An Observational Study

CONTEXT: Achieving inpatient glycemic control in patients who are nil per os (NPO), on enteral tube feedings (TF), or total parental nutrition (TPN) remains extremely challenging. OBJECTIVE: To determine if, for inpatients with hyperglycemia who are NPO, on TF, or on TPN, an automated self-adjusting subcutaneous rapid-acting insulin algorithm (SQIA) we developed and programmed into the electronic medical record (EMR) leads to improvements in glucose control compared to conventional insulin treatment (CI). METHODS: Retrospective cohort study using EMR data from September 3, 2020, to September 2, 2023, of all adult inpatients, comparing point-of-care (POC) glucose measurements between patients on SQIA vs CI and either NPO, or on TF, or on TPN. The analysis looked at the proportion of q4 hour POC glucose levels in the following ranges: hypoglycemia (<70 mg/dL), in range (71-180 mg/dL), moderate hyperglycemia (181-250 mg/dL), and severe hyperglycemia (>250 mg/dL). RESULTS: There were 5031 intervals (associated with 4310 hospitalizations) in which the patient was NPO or on TF or TPN and on the SQIA (73.5%) or CI (26.5%). The proportion of glucose values in the hypoglycemic and severely hyperglycemic ranges were significantly lower in the SQIA group vs the CI group (hypoglycemia: 0.65% vs 1.10%; difference -0.45%; -0.62 to -0.28%; P < .001; hyperglycemia: 5.40% vs 6.65%; difference -1.25%; -2.03% to -0.46%; P = .002). With glucocorticoids, severe hyperglycemia rates were lower for patients on SQIA, particularly those receiving high-dose glucocorticoids (11.1% lower). CONCLUSION: Patients had a lower proportion of both hypoglycemic and severely hyperglycemic measurements when their blood glucose levels were managed using the SQIA than when managed using conventional physician-driven insulin orders.
